Windows in Barrow Upon Soar
MisterWhat has found 1 results for Windows in Barrow Upon Soar.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Southworth Developments Ltd
261 Sileby Road
Barrow Upon Soar, Loughborough LE12 8LP
261 Sileby Road
Barrow Upon Soar, Loughborough LE12 8LP
Related results
N Townend
33, Ribble Drive
Barrow Upon Soar, Loughborough LE12 8LJ
33, Ribble Drive
Barrow Upon Soar, Loughborough LE12 8LJ
The Panel Co Ltd
26, Hayhill
Barrow Upon Soar, Loughborough LE12 8LD
26, Hayhill
Barrow Upon Soar, Loughborough LE12 8LD